Welcome to our needlepoint journey! In this post, we’ll be exploring the Norwich Stitch, also known as the Waffle Stitch—a beautiful and textured design that adds depth and charm to your canvas. Perfect for both beginners and experienced stitchers, this stitch creates a raised, woven look that’s eye-catching yet easy to master. Whether you’re working on a decorative piece or enhancing your needlepoint sampler, the Norwich/Waffle Stitch is a wonderful technique to add variety and elegance to your work.
